Race in Kirby

The most populous races in Kirby are White / Caucasian (37 | 77.1%), Two or more Races (11 | 22.9%), and Hispanic or Latino (5 | 10.4%).

Ancestry in Kirby

The most populous ancestries reported in Kirby are German (18 | 37.5%), Irish (9 | 18.8%), Cherokee (5 | 10.4%), Mexican (5 | 10.4%), and English (4 | 8.3%), together accounting for 85.4% of all Kirby residents.
